llvm/include/llvm/ExecutionEngine/Orc/Shared/VTuneSharedStructs.h
This file contains hidden or bidirectional Unicode text that may be interpreted or compiled differently than what appears below. To review, open the file in an editor that reveals hidden Unicode characters.
Learn more about bidirectional Unicode characters
Original file line number | Diff line number | Diff line change |
---|---|---|
@@ -0,0 +1,102 @@ | ||
//===-------------------- VTuneSharedStructs.h ------------------*- C++ -*-===// | ||
// | ||
//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ions. | ||
// See https://llvm.org/LICENSE.txt for license information. | ||
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ception | ||
// | ||
//===----------------------------------------------------------------------===// | ||
// | ||
// Structs and serialization to share VTune-related information | ||
// | ||
//===----------------------------------------------------------------------===// | ||
|
||
#ifndef LLVM_EXECUTIONENGINE_ORC_SHARED_VTUNESHAREDSTRUCTS_H | ||
#define LLVM_EXECUTIONENGINE_ORC_SHARED_VTUNESHAREDSTRUCTS_H | ||
|
||
namespace llvm { | ||
namespace orc { | ||
|
||
using VTuneLineTable = std::vector<std::pair<unsigned, unsigned>>; | ||
|
||
// SI = String Index, 1-indexed into the VTuneMethodBatch::Strings table. | ||
// SI == 0 means replace with nullptr. | ||
|
||
// MI = Method Index, 1-indexed into the VTuneMethodBatch::Methods table. | ||
// MI == 0 means this is a parent method and was not inlined. | ||
|
||
struct VTuneMethodInfo { | ||
VTuneLineTable LineTable; | ||
ExecutorAddr LoadAddr; | ||
uint64_t LoadSize; | ||
uint64_t MethodID; | ||
uint32_t NameSI; | ||
uint32_t ClassFileSI; | ||
uint32_t SourceFileSI; | ||
uint32_t ParentMI; | ||
}; | ||
|
||
using VTuneMethodTable = std::vector<VTuneMethodInfo>; | ||
using VTuneStringTable = std::vector<std::string>; | ||
|
||
struct VTuneMethodBatch { | ||
VTuneMethodTable Methods; | ||
VTuneStringTable Strings; | ||
}; | ||
|
||
using VTuneUnloadedMethodIDs = SmallVector<std::pair<uint64_t, uint64_t>>; | ||
|
||
namespace shared { | ||
|
||
using SPSVTuneLineTable = SPSSequence<SPSTuple<uint32_t, uint32_t>>; | ||
using SPSVTuneMethodInfo = | ||
SPSTuple<SPSVTuneLineTable, SPSExecutorAddr, uint64_t, uint64_t, uint32_t, | ||
uint32_t, uint32_t, uint32_t>; | ||
using SPSVTuneMethodTable = SPSSequence<SPSVTuneMethodInfo>; | ||
using SPSVTuneStringTable = SPSSequence<SPSString>; | ||
using SPSVTuneMethodBatch = SPSTuple<SPSVTuneMethodTable, SPSVTuneStringTable>; | ||
using SPSVTuneUnloadedMethodIDs = SPSSequence<SPSTuple<uint64_t, uint64_t>>; | ||
|
||
template <> class SPSSerializationTraits<SPSVTuneMethodInfo, VTuneMethodInfo> { | ||
public: | ||
static size_t size(const VTuneMethodInfo &MI) { | ||
return SPSVTuneMethodInfo::AsArgList::size( | ||
MI.LineTable, MI.LoadAddr, MI.LoadSize, MI.MethodID, MI.NameSI, | ||
MI.ClassFileSI, MI.SourceFileSI, MI.ParentMI); | ||
} | ||
|
||
static bool deserialize(SPSInputBuffer &IB, VTuneMethodInfo &MI) { | ||
return SPSVTuneMethodInfo::AsArgList::deserialize( | ||
IB, MI.LineTable, MI.LoadAddr, MI.LoadSize, MI.MethodID, MI.NameSI, | ||
MI.ClassFileSI, MI.SourceFileSI, MI.ParentMI); | ||
} | ||
|
||
static bool serialize(SPSOutputBuffer &OB, const VTuneMethodInfo &MI) { | ||
return SPSVTuneMethodInfo::AsArgList::serialize( | ||
OB, MI.LineTable, MI.LoadAddr, MI.LoadSize, MI.MethodID, MI.NameSI, | ||
MI.ClassFileSI, MI.SourceFileSI, MI.ParentMI); | ||
} | ||
}; | ||
|
||
template <> | ||
class SPSSerializationTraits<SPSVTuneMethodBatch, VTuneMethodBatch> { | ||
public: | ||
static size_t size(const VTuneMethodBatch &MB) { | ||
return SPSVTuneMethodBatch::AsArgList::size(MB.Methods, MB.Strings); | ||
} | ||
|
||
static bool deserialize(SPSInputBuffer &IB, VTuneMethodBatch &MB) { | ||
return SPSVTuneMethodBatch::AsArgList::deserialize(IB, MB.Methods, | ||
MB.Strings); | ||
} | ||
|
||
static bool serialize(SPSOutputBuffer &OB, const VTuneMethodBatch &MB) { | ||
return SPSVTuneMethodBatch::AsArgList::serialize(OB, MB.Methods, | ||
MB.Strings); | ||
} | ||
}; | ||
|
||
} // end namespace shared | ||
} // end namespace orc | ||
} // end namespace llvm | ||
|
||
#endif |

llvm/lib/ExecutionEngine/Orc/Debugging/VTuneSupportPlugin.cpp
This file contains hidden or bidirectional Unicode text that may be interpreted or compiled differently than what appears below. To review, open the file in an editor that reveals hidden Unicode characters.
Learn more about bidirectional Unicode characters
Original file line number | Diff line number | Diff line change |
---|---|---|
@@ -0,0 +1,185 @@ | ||
//===--- VTuneSupportPlugin.cpp -- Support for VTune profiler --*- C++ -*--===// | ||
// | ||
//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ions. | ||
// See https://llvm.org/LICENSE.txt for license information. | ||
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ception | ||
// | ||
//===----------------------------------------------------------------------===// | ||
// | ||
// Handles support for registering code with VIntel Tune's Amplfiier JIT API. | ||
// | ||
//===----------------------------------------------------------------------===// | ||
#include "llvm/ExecutionEngine/Orc/Debugging/VTuneSupportPlugin.h" | ||
#include "llvm/DebugInfo/DWARF/DWARFContext.h" | ||
#include "llvm/ExecutionEngine/Orc/Debugging/DebugInfoSupport.h" | ||
|
||
using namespace llvm; | ||
using namespace llvm::orc; | ||
using namespace llvm::jitlink; | ||
|
||
static constexpr StringRef RegisterVTuneImplName = "llvm_orc_registerVTuneImpl"; | ||
static constexpr StringRef UnregisterVTuneImplName = | ||
"llvm_orc_unregisterVTuneImpl"; | ||
static constexpr StringRef RegisterTestVTuneImplName = | ||
"llvm_orc_test_registerVTuneImpl"; | ||
|
||
static VTuneMethodBatch getMethodBatch(LinkGraph &G, bool EmitDebugInfo) { | ||
VTuneMethodBatch Batch; | ||
std::unique_ptr<DWARFContext> DC; | ||
StringMap<std::unique_ptr<MemoryBuffer>> DCBacking; | ||
if (EmitDebugInfo) { | ||
auto EDC = createDWARFContext(G); | ||
if (!EDC) { | ||
EmitDebugInfo = false; | ||
} else { | ||
DC = std::move(EDC->first); | ||
DCBacking = std::move(EDC->second); | ||
} | ||
} | ||
|
||
auto GetStringIdx = [Deduplicator = StringMap<uint32_t>(), | ||
&Batch](StringRef S) mutable { | ||
auto I = Deduplicator.find(S); | ||
if (I != Deduplicator.end()) | ||
return I->second; | ||
|
||
Batch.Strings.push_back(S.str()); | ||
return Deduplicator[S] = Batch.Strings.size(); | ||
}; | ||
for (auto Sym : G.defined_symbols()) { | ||
if (!Sym->isCallable()) | ||
continue; | ||
|
||
Batch.Methods.push_back(VTuneMethodInfo()); | ||
auto &Method = Batch.Methods.back(); | ||
Method.MethodID = 0; | ||
Method.ParentMI = 0; | ||
Method.LoadAddr = Sym->getAddress(); | ||
Method.LoadSize = Sym->getSize(); | ||
Method.NameSI = GetStringIdx(Sym->getName()); | ||
Method.ClassFileSI = 0; | ||
Method.SourceFileSI = 0; | ||
|
||
if (!EmitDebugInfo) | ||
continue; | ||
|
||
auto &Section = Sym->getBlock().getSection(); | ||
auto Addr = Sym->getAddress(); | ||
auto SAddr = | ||
object::SectionedAddress{Addr.getValue(), Section.getOrdinal()}; | ||
DILineInfoTable LinesInfo = DC->getLineInfoForAddressRange( | ||
SAddr, Sym->getSize(), | ||
DILineInfoSpecifier::FileLineInfoKind::AbsoluteFilePath); | ||
Method.SourceFileSI = Batch.Strings.size(); | ||
Batch.Strings.push_back(DC->getLineInfoForAddress(SAddr).FileName); | ||
for (auto &LInfo : LinesInfo) { | ||
Method.LineTable.push_back( | ||
std::pair<unsigned, unsigned>{/*unsigned*/ Sym->getOffset(), | ||
/*DILineInfo*/ LInfo.second.Line}); | ||
} | ||
} | ||
return Batch; | ||
} | ||
|
||
void VTuneSupportPlugin::modifyPassConfig(MaterializationResponsibility &MR, | ||
LinkGraph &G, | ||
PassConfiguration &Config) { | ||
Config.PostFixupPasses.push_back([this, MR = &MR](LinkGraph &G) { | ||
// the object file is generated but not linked yet | ||
auto Batch = getMethodBatch(G, EmitDebugInfo); | ||
if (Batch.Methods.empty()) { | ||
return Error::success(); | ||
} | ||
{ | ||
std::lock_guard<std::mutex> Lock(PluginMutex); | ||
uint64_t Allocated = Batch.Methods.size(); | ||
uint64_t Start = NextMethodID; | ||
NextMethodID += Allocated; | ||
for (size_t i = Start; i < NextMethodID; ++i) { | ||
Batch.Methods[i - Start].MethodID = i; | ||
} | ||
this->PendingMethodIDs[MR] = {Start, Allocated}; | ||
} | ||
G.allocActions().push_back( | ||
{cantFail(shared::WrapperFunctionCall::Create< | ||
shared::SPSArgList<shared::SPSVTuneMethodBatch>>( | ||
RegisterVTuneImplAddr, Batch)), | ||
{}}); | ||
return Error::success(); | ||
}); | ||
} | ||
|
||
Error VTuneSupportPlugin::notifyEmitted(MaterializationResponsibility &MR) { | ||
if (auto Err = MR.withResourceKeyDo([this, MR = &MR](ResourceKey K) { | ||
std::lock_guard<std::mutex> Lock(PluginMutex); | ||
auto I = PendingMethodIDs.find(MR); | ||
if (I == PendingMethodIDs.end()) | ||
return; | ||
|
||
LoadedMethodIDs[K].push_back(I->second); | ||
PendingMethodIDs.erase(I); | ||
})) { | ||
return Err; | ||
} | ||
return Error::success(); | ||
} | ||
|
||
Error VTuneSupportPlugin::notifyFailed(MaterializationResponsibility &MR) { | ||
std::lock_guard<std::mutex> Lock(PluginMutex); | ||
PendingMethodIDs.erase(&MR); | ||
return Error::success(); | ||
} | ||
|
||
Error VTuneSupportPlugin::notifyRemovingResources(JITDylib &JD, ResourceKey K) { | ||
// Unregistration not required if not provided | ||
if (!UnregisterVTuneImplAddr) { | ||
return Error::success(); | ||
} | ||
VTuneUnloadedMethodIDs UnloadedIDs; | ||
{ | ||
std::lock_guard<std::mutex> Lock(PluginMutex); | ||
auto I = LoadedMethodIDs.find(K); | ||
if (I == LoadedMethodIDs.end()) | ||
return Error::success(); | ||
|
||
UnloadedIDs = std::move(I->second); | ||
LoadedMethodIDs.erase(I); | ||
} | ||
if (auto Err = EPC.callSPSWrapper<void(shared::SPSVTuneUnloadedMethodIDs)>( | ||
UnregisterVTuneImplAddr, UnloadedIDs)) | ||
return Err; | ||
|
||
return Error::success(); | ||
} | ||
|
||
void VTuneSupportPlugin::notifyTransferringResources(JITDylib &JD, | ||
ResourceKey DstKey, | ||
ResourceKey SrcKey) { | ||
std::lock_guard<std::mutex> Lock(PluginMutex); | ||
auto I = LoadedMethodIDs.find(SrcKey); | ||
if (I == LoadedMethodIDs.end()) | ||
return; | ||
|
||
auto &Dest = LoadedMethodIDs[DstKey]; | ||
Dest.insert(Dest.end(), I->second.begin(), I->second.end()); | ||
LoadedMethodIDs.erase(SrcKey); | ||
} | ||
|
||
Expected<std::unique_ptr<VTuneSupportPlugin>> | ||
VTuneSupportPlugin::Create(ExecutorProcessControl &EPC, JITDylib &JD, | ||
bool EmitDebugInfo, bool TestMode) { | ||
auto &ES = EPC.getExecutionSession(); | ||
auto RegisterImplName = | ||
ES.intern(TestMode ? RegisterTestVTuneImplName : RegisterVTuneImplName); | ||
auto UnregisterImplName = ES.intern(UnregisterVTuneImplName); | ||
SymbolLookupSet SLS{RegisterImplName, UnregisterImplName}; | ||
auto Res = ES.lookup(makeJITDylibSearchOrder({&JD}), std::move(SLS)); | ||
if (!Res) | ||
return Res.takeError(); | ||
ExecutorAddr RegisterImplAddr( | ||
Res->find(RegisterImplName)->second.getAddress()); | ||
ExecutorAddr UnregisterImplAddr( | ||
Res->find(UnregisterImplName)->second.getAddress()); | ||
return std::make_unique<VTuneSupportPlugin>( | ||
EPC, RegisterImplAddr, UnregisterImplAddr, EmitDebugInfo); | ||
} |
